随着互联网技术的迅猛发展,社交和即时通讯的需求日益增长。IM 2.0(即时通讯2.0)作为一种全新的通讯方式,为用户提供了更加丰富的功能和更流畅的交互体验。与此同时,API(应用程序编程接口)的出现,为各类软件系统之间的互联互通提供了可能性。这使得 IM 2.0 的集成及其与其他服务的对接成为一种流行趋势。
在本文中,我们将全面分析 IM 2.0 与 API 对接所带来的优势与挑战,并探讨相关的实际案例及未来的发展方向。
### 2. IM 2.0 与 API 对接的优势 #### 提升用户体验IM 2.0 的对接 API 可以极大地提升用户体验。通过网站或应用程序中的实时通讯功能,用户可以随时随地与他人进行交流,增强了互动的灵活性。例如,通过对接社交媒体平台的 API,用户可以方便地在聊天中分享链接、图片和其他内容,这样不仅提高了用户的活跃度,还增强了用户之间的联系。
#### 实现多功能整合API 的引入可以将 IM 2.0 的功能与其他应用程序无缝整合。比如,企业可以通过对接 CRM 系统的 API 来实现即时通讯与客户管理的整合,客服人员能够即时获取客户的信息,从而快速响应客户的需求。这种多功能整合不仅有效提高了工作效率,还为企业创造了更大的商业价值。
#### 增强系统的灵活性和扩展性IM 2.0 的对接 API 使得系统更加灵活。例如,企业可以根据需求随时添加或修改功能,而不需要对整个系统进行重构。一旦某个新功能需要上线,只需更新 API 调用即可。这使得企业能够迅速适应市场变化,更好地响应用户需求。
### 3. IM 2.0 与 API 对接的挑战 #### 技术难度尽管 IM 2.0 与 API 的对接带来了诸多便利,但技术上的挑战也不容忽视。不同系统之间的对接需要强大的技术后台支持,包括数据格式转换、通讯协议的匹配等。此外,开发者需要全面了解 API 文档,才能顺利完成接口的调用和集成。这对技术团队的能力提出了更高的要求。
#### 数据安全性在对接过程中,数据安全性是一个非常重要的方面。由于 API 的开放特性,可能会引入安全风险。例如,用户的私人信息在传输过程中可能会被窃取。如果不采取有效的加密措施,用户的数据泄露将对企业造成重大的损失。因此,在对接 IM 2.0 和 API 的过程中,必须确保采用良好的安全措施,如 SSL 加密等。
#### 接口标准化问题API 的多样化使得对接变得更加复杂。市场上存在多种形式的 API,标准不一,导致开发者在对接时需要花费更多的时间去理解和适应不同的接口规范。这种非标准化现象,增加了项目的复杂性,并可能导致开发周期的延长。
### 4. 实际案例分析 #### 成功的 IM 2.0 与 API 对接实例某知名企业通过对接 IM 2.0 与其电商平台的 API,使得用户在浏览商品时可以直接通过聊天窗口咨询客服。这一功能不仅提高了服务效率,还显著提升了客户满意度和转化率。通过数据分析,该企业的客户咨询响应速度缩短了50%,最终实现了销售额的大幅提升。
#### 失败案例的教训然而,并非所有的对接都是成功的。一些企业在实施 IM 2.0 与 API 的对接时,由于缺乏前期的充分调研和准备,导致项目实施后效果不佳,用户体验下降。比如,有一家企业在接口标准化方面未能对接好,导致用户在使用过程中的诸多障碍,最终造成客户流失和品牌形象受损。这个教训提醒我们,良好的前期规划和实施是成功的关键。
### 5. 未来趋势与发展方向 #### 人工智能与 IM 2.0 的结合随着人工智能技术的发展,IM 2.0 与 AI 的结合将会成为未来的一大趋势。例如,通过引入智能客服机器人,可以实现24小时无间断服务,进一步提升用户体验。同时,基于大数据的分析,可以定制个性化的推荐,使用户在使用过程中获得更为精准的服务。
#### 开放平台与社区协作未来,IM 2.0 的发展方向将更加注重开放平台和社区协作。通过构建开放的 API 生态系统,开发者可以更自由地创新与开发新的应用场景。在这样的环境中,各类应用系统之间的协同效应将被最大化,推动整个行业的进步。
### 6. 常见问题解答 #### IM 2.0 与 API 对接的常见误区很多人常常误以为 IM 2.0 的对接仅仅是技术层面的事情,实际上它更涉及到业务需求与用户体验的结合。只有当对接目标明确,才能有效指导技术实施。
#### 对接过程中可能遇到的技术问题在对接过程中,技术兼容性问题是最常见的。例如,旧版系统与新版API之间的差异常常导致接口无法正常调用。为此,开发者需要认真测试,并准备好相应的回退方案。
#### 如何选择合适的 API选择合适的 API 需要考虑多个因素,包括文档的完整性、社区支持、稳定性等。通过试用和评估,可以更好地选择出适合自己项目的 API。
#### 数据隐私保护的策略在对接 API 的同时,企业必须遵守数据保护法律法规,确保用户隐私得到保护。例如,通过数据加密、访问权限控制等手段,确保敏感数据不会被泄露。
#### 性能的建议对接后,性能尤为重要。可以通过对缓存机制的、请求并发数的控制等手段,提高系统响应速度,提升用户体验。
#### 实施后的评估与调整在对接完成后,企业应建立定期检查机制,及时发现问题并进行调整。借助用户反馈,可更好地系统,提高用户满意度。
通过以上六个问题的深入分析,我们可以更全面地理解 IM 2.0 与 API 的对接,不仅要看到其中的优势,还需要关注面临的挑战,确保在实际应用中取得良好的效果。